    K-Beauty is Ancient History | Korean Skincare Before Hallyu - EP42

    You can’t be a skincare fan and not know about K-Beauty. Today we are talking about the history behind Korea’s astonishing rise to global beauty powerhouse. It’s more than just cosmetic, it’s a story of resilience, strategy, and innovation. Most Americans overlook Korea’s deep history, but a centuries-old story of oppression, evolution, and social shifts laid the groundwork for today’s K-beauty craze. This episode is for anyone wondering how history can shape beauty standards.  We cover: How ancient Korean beauty standards prioritized external health and inner vitality. Skincare using ingredients like rice water, green tea, and ginseng. The fascinating roles women like the Gisang played as both entertainers and pioneers of skincare techniques, including early double cleansing. The impact of Korea’s political upheavals, from Japanese occupation and the Korean War to the rise of Hallyu, in shaping the industry’s resilience and innovation. The emergence of iconic products like Bakgabun powder, and its lead poisoning downfall, highlighting early challenges in establishing successful skincare lines.     Can Skincare Products Cure Weight Loss Side Effects? - EP41

    I bet you have heard of Ozempic, but did you know it was first discovered in Gila Monster venom? This week we are talking about weight loss drugs, and the shocking side effects they can cause. If you're curious about the science, the beauty industry's profit-driven response, and why these weight-loss drugs might be doing more harm than good, this episode is your essential guide. We talk about the mechanism of action, and how it's used for managing blood sugar and suppressing appetite. We’re talking all about how and why these drugs work, and why their popularity has skyrocketed beyond medical need into the realm of aesthetic obsession. We break down the real risks, like facial volume loss, "Ozempic face," and the accelerated aging many users are experiencing. We reveal how the beauty and skincare industry is quick to cash in on these side effects, marketing products that promise to reverse or hide the very issues caused by these powerful medications. You'll learn why topical treatments and expensive serums are often a marketing illusion that can't substitute real medical procedures for lifting or tightening skin.     Why Does Isotretinoin Work SO WELL? History and Controversy Behind Accutane - EP 40

    This week we are diving deep into Accutane, also known as isotretinoin. This is one of the most talked about acne treatments in dermatology. If you’ve ever wondered how Accutane works, why skin can get worse before it gets better, what the purge phase feels like, or whether Accutane is actually safe, this episode breaks it all down in a science-backed, easy-to-understand way. We cover the accidental discovery of Accutane, the history behind isotretinoin, how it targets sebaceous glands and oil production, and why it’s often considered a last-resort treatment for severe or stubborn acne. We also talk about common Accutane side effects like dry skin, dry lips, bloody noses, joint pain, vision changes, and increased breakouts during the purge phase. You’ll also learn about the iPledge system, the required pregnancy prevention program, the controversy around its new rollout, and the reasons dermatologists and patients have criticized it.  We are discussing the real-world experience of going on Accutane, as well as the emotional side of dealing with Acne.     EVERYTHING You Need To Know Before Using Bemotrizinol | The HOTTEST New Sunscreen Active! - EP 39

    EMERGENCY SUNSCREEN UPDATE!  The FDA just approved the first UV filter in over 20 years! Join us for breaking news in US sunscreens. This ingredient promises to be the safest and most effective filter the United States Market has ever seen, but what does that actually mean as a consumer?  This week we are telling you EVERYTHING you need to know about Bemotrizinol, BEMT, bis-ethylhexyloxyphenol methoxyphenyl triazine (Which is actually still an INCI name, not IUPAC) Tinosorb S, or Parsol SHIELD. Whatever you decide to call it, we are here to break down what it means for the future of your sun protection products.  Plus we are diving into the history of sunscreen regulation, and explaining why this ingredient is brand new in the US, but has been used abroad for almost 20 years. If you’ve ever wondered why American sunscreens feel different from those in Europe or Korea, this episode unpacks the complex history behind US regulations and the science behind a game-changing sunscreen active, BEMT. We are unpacking how this new ingredient offers broader UV protection, reduces skin irritation, and could finally end the white cast nightmare.     Can Makeup Be Good For Your Skin? BB Creams, K-Beauty and More! EP 37

    Is there a line between makeup and skincare? If there is, it's extremely blurry, and understanding the science behind it can change the way you approach your beauty routine. In this eye-opening episode, cosmetic chemists Sadie and Natalie peel back the layers of what truly goes into your favorite complexion products. from BB creams with origins in 1960s Germany to the skin tints that are still very popular today. Discover the surprising history of BB and CC creams and why they’re more than just beauty trends, but a reflection of industry shifts, inclusivity challenges, and innovative formulations. You'll learn about the pigments added to skincare and makeup, the difference between oil-soluble and insoluble colorants, and why each ingredient in a product can impact it’s texture, wearability, and skin benefits. We break down the complex chemistry behind oil-based formulas, explaining why many makeup products are potentially good for skin, despite their ‘call out’ ingredients.  This episode dives deep into currently available products like concealers, skin tints, and SPF makeup.     The Complex World of Color Cosmetics: Outsourcing Secrets Behind Your Favorite Skincare - EP 36

    We are unlocking the secret differences between makeup and skincare formulations and discover why most companies excel in one, but not both.  Cosmetic chemists Sadie and Natalie pull back the curtain on how the beauty industry structures its product development, from the complex web of outsourcing to the specialized labs that craft your favorite products. They explore the vast “umbrella” of cosmetics, breaking down why makeup (color cosmetics) require such painstaking precision, and how formulating a lipstick or foundation is a whole different ballgame from creating a serum or night cream. You'll learn about the intricacies of color matching, the high cost of pigments, and our opinion on why darker shades may be less common.  Listen to this episode now and discover:  How the cosmetic industry separates color cosmetics from skincare and why they’re often produced at different facilities The specialized skill sets required to craft liquids, solids, powders, and aerosols, and why not every lab can do it all Why color accuracy in makeup is so critical, and how formulation impacts everything from shade range to product stability The role of active ingredients and how their concentration impacts efficacy, compared to the immediate visual impact of color cosmetics The hidden costs behind pigment selection and why darker shades tend to be more expensive to produce How FDA regulations influence color choices and ingredient options in the US market This episode is perfect for beauty lovers, aspiring formulators, or anyone curious about what goes into the products they use every day.
